Ahimsa (non-violence) is the most fundamental principle of Yoga. It extends way beyond the physical. It represents freedom from anger and fear. In asana practice it means respecting the body’s physical limits while being patient and avoiding aggressive/forceful actions. It means waiting for the breath to indicate when one is ready to go deeper into a posture and attentively listening to feedback from the body.
Asanas are much more than exercise or positioning the body. When one practices correctly, the asanas create a true and complete union of the body and mind. Years of sustained effort and concentration are needed to become a master of yoga asanas. Only precise and correct alignment will allow the practitioner to derive the full therapeutic benefits. Anatomy and biomechanics have to be respected. There should not be any compression or tension while practicing. Muscles and bones should be positioned in such a way that minimal effort is required in the pose even for an extended period of time.
The weakest part of human body is the lower back area. To create greater stability in this area we will focus on ways to strengthen the core. The muscles that surround the lumbar spine need to be strong, flexible and balanced in order to support the spine and internal organs properly. The body’ gravity center is situated there. It is a source of our vital force and energy. Every single movement should originate from the core!
